Transaction 815a41d0893b311615620a3c7360c576d8b0949245c4e5baf93355147304a28b

1 Input
2 Outputs
  • 815a41d0893b311615620a3c7360c576d8b0949245c4e5baf93355147304a28b:0
  • value  242841
    address  39hceL5YqqiEcGa5D47V8SccCNMvXTtJxS
  • 815a41d0893b311615620a3c7360c576d8b0949245c4e5baf93355147304a28b:1
  • value  101229167
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D